			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>It looks increasing likely that New Firefox Mobile browser will launch within days according to various sources.</p>
<p>Initially it will be downloadable from the Nokia OVI store for N900 users. Following on from this it looks like early next year there will be versions for Windows Mobile and Android.</p>
<p>Neat features include the option to sync the desktop browser with the mobile version. Watch this space, you can be guaranteed that this will be a nice piece of kit once it arrives.</p>

<p>Seems like internet music streaming service Spotify has been struggling to keep up with the demand for Christmas tunes. Some users have been reporting slow performance and songs streaming in super slow-mo for the past 24 hours or so!</p>
<p>A statement from the company says:</p>
<p>“Spotify has seen a huge surge in use over the Christmas period as music fans search out their festive favourites. As a result an extremely small percentage of users may have been affected over the past 24 hours.”</p>
<p>“We’ve moved quickly to add extra servers so this should see Spotify back at full capacity. Apologies to anyone who may have been been temporarily affected – we’re always working hard to ensure you experience the best music service possible.”</p>
<p>Hopefully this is resolved sooner rather then later. As a regular Spotify Premium user i love the service they provide and know what a great service it is. However, stories like this do nothing to help their profile with a US launch imminent in early 2010.</p>
